What I Dream Is Nothing Further Than Reality
What I dream
is nothing further than reality;
does it seem
unrealistic to reach equality?
Is there enough time
to fulfill a life far from sublime...
renouncing one's joy
to give up all without pride or glory?
What I dream...what I dream
is nothing further than reality;
hope can definitely gleam
as far as the planet of Mercury.
Isn't love wonderful when it is felt by a lonely child...
when everyone happily gives of themselves?
Will their sacrifice teach some to be humble and kind?
Can every heart love without boundaries?
What I dream...what I dream,
may not be realized in this century,
but the seed of hope has been planted by a stream,
and every spring it will bring forth true harmony.
Faces and eyes of all colors
will sing the hymn of unity;
wouldn't God be happy to see love in their innocent eyes?
Can they unify, with their sweetness, the entire Humanity?
What I dream...what I dream
is nothing further than reality;
it may not be achieved in this lifetime, indeed....
but it isn't an uncertainty or impossibility.
